Common Trane Air Duct Cleaning Problems We Solve in Finneytown
- Secondary heat exchanger pinholing in XR80/XR95 units. Trane’s XR series secondary heat exchangers develop pinhole corrosion after 12–15 years in humid basement installations — exactly what we find in Finneytown’s ranch crawlspaces. Exhaust particulates containing carbon monoxide byproducts leak into the return air stream, coating ducts with a fine, hazardous film that standard vacuuming won’t remove. We document this with video inspection before cleaning.
- Variable-speed blower moisture pull in XV20i systems. Trane’s XV20i variable-speed blowers move more air volume across dirty evaporator coils, wicking excess condensation into the supply plenum. In Finneytown’s older systems — already loaded with decades of dust — this creates biofilm growth that recirculates musty odors through every register. Evaporator coil cleaning is non-negotiable here.
- Fiberglass duct board delamination under static pressure. Finneytown’s original 1950s–60s duct liner sheds fibers when Trane’s higher static pressure hits aging fiberglass. We video-document this deterioration before every cleaning in 45224; it’s a liability issue that rarely surfaces in newer Mason or West Chester subdivisions with flex-duct construction.
- Unsealed return plenums drawing crawlspace contamination. Large-diameter sheet-metal trunk lines in Finneytown’s unconditioned crawlspaces develop joint gaps over decades. Trane systems with negative pressure returns pull mouse droppings, pest debris, and groundwater vapor directly into the airstream. Duct sealing with mastic precedes cleaning — otherwise you’re just vacuuming a sieve.
- Mold colonization in poorly insulated supply ducts. The Ohio Valley’s high late-spring humidity hits Finneytown hard. Condensation forms inside uninsulated older ducts, and Trane’s extended cooling cycles — necessary in these humid continental summers — keep those surfaces wet longer. Standard cleaning removes debris; our Air Quality & Sanitizing service addresses the root biological growth.

Standard duct cleaning alone rarely eliminates musty odors in Finneytown’s Trane systems. The smell typically originates at the evaporator coil and drain pan, where biofilm forms during humid summer cycles. Trane’s XV20i variable-speed blowers are especially prone to this — the extended low-speed operation keeps coils wet longer. We bundle coil cleaning with duct service when odor is the complaint.
